OverviewThe Senior Employee Relations (ER) Manager ensures Amazon’s readiness considering the forthcoming EU regulations and looks after trade union management, employee engagement, and organizational transformation across EU. This role is part of the Employee Experience and Relations (EXR) team, reporting directly to the EU EXR Risk, Project and Compliance leader. The role requires close collaboration with various stakeholders at country, Business lines (BL), pan-EU and global level (notably the Global Labor Relations Team). By doing so, this role enhances Amazon’s compliance, drives positive employee engagement on essential priorities, and increases Amazon’s agility to manage ambiguous and complex situations.

This role can be performed from the following countries: France, Italy, Spain, Germany, Luxembourg, UK. Travel is required up to 30% of the time, mostly within the EU.

Responsibilities

EU REGULATORY COMPLIANCE AND COORDINATION

Working with Public Policy to identify approved and emerging regulations

Conducting impact analysis at pan-EU level, and support gap analysis across EU countries

Coordinating the preparation required at country level

Being accountable for the EXR working backward plan of the CSRD and CSDDD

THIRD-PARTY STRATEGY MANAGEMENT

Maintain up-to-date information and external insights about relevant developments and trends

Develop engagement strategies in collaboration with Public Policy and Public Relations

Provide reactive and proactive recommendations for third-party management, notably in case of significant development (UK reform)

EMPLOYEE ENGAGEMENT AND PROUDNESS CAMPAIGNS

Design and deliver training actions to enhance ER capacities within the HR and senior leaders’ functions

Collaborate with Public Relations and Internal Operations Communications to design and develop campaigns that enhance employee pride at Amazon

Lead test and learn initiatives, creative thinking, and action to improve employee sentiment

LABOR RELATIONS FRAMEWORK DEVELOPMENT

Develop the LR framework for major transformation cycles (e.g., site lifecycle milestones) to increase pan-EU standardization, lower costs, and reduce time to deliver while enhancing stakeholders and Associate satisfaction

Basic Qualifications

Bachelor''s degree in Employment Law, Industrial Relations, or a related field

Experience in Employee and Labor Relations management with a focus on pan-EU coverage; experience in managing complex stakeholder relationships in a matrix environment, including third-party engagement at EU federation level

Fluency in both written and spoken English (CEFR C2) and at least one other European language, including French, Spanish, Italian, or German

Preferred Qualifications

Master''s degree in a related field

Analytical and problem-solving skills with the ability to translate complex ELR concepts into actionable strategies

Communication and influencing skills, with the ability to engage effectively at all levels of the organization and persevere over internal and external barriers to drive resolutions

Ability to produce high-quality written communications that concisely analyze problems and move solutions from concept to execution

Capable of working independently in fast-paced, ambiguous environments
